The recent arrest of former Philippines President Rodrigo Duterte has sparked significant legal controversy. Accusations have emerged from his ex-legal team, led by Salvador Panelo, challenging the legitimacy of the process.

Panelo stated that Duterte had no legal representation at the time of his arrest and criticized the Interpol warrant's credibility, alleging it originated from a questionable source. He emphasized that the International Criminal Court holds no power in the country since the Philippines is no longer a member.

However, the ICC maintains it has jurisdiction over cases involving alleged crimes committed before the Philippines formally withdrew, setting the stage for a complex legal battle.
